21 references to TestEntity
Microsoft.AspNetCore.Components.QuickGrid.Tests (21)
GridSortTest.cs (21)
31Expression<Func<TestEntity, string>> expression = x => x.Name;
34var gridSort = GridSort<TestEntity>.ByAscending(expression);
47Expression<Func<TestEntity, DateTime?>> expression = x => x.NullableDate;
50var gridSort = GridSort<TestEntity>.ByAscending(expression);
63Expression<Func<TestEntity, int?>> expression = x => x.NullableInt;
66var gridSort = GridSort<TestEntity>.ByAscending(expression);
79Expression<Func<TestEntity, string>> expression = x => x.Child.ChildName;
82var gridSort = GridSort<TestEntity>.ByAscending(expression);
95Expression<Func<TestEntity, DateTime?>> expression = x => x.Child.ChildNullableDate;
98var gridSort = GridSort<TestEntity>.ByAscending(expression);
111Expression<Func<TestEntity, DateTime?>> expression = x => x.NullableDate;
114var gridSort = GridSort<TestEntity>.ByDescending(expression);
127Expression<Func<TestEntity, string>> firstExpression = x => x.Name;
128Expression<Func<TestEntity, DateTime?>> secondExpression = x => x.NullableDate;
131var gridSort = GridSort<TestEntity>.ByAscending(firstExpression)
151Expression<Func<TestEntity, string>> invalidExpression = x => x.Name.ToUpper(CultureInfo.InvariantCulture);
154var gridSort = GridSort<TestEntity>.ByAscending(invalidExpression);
163Expression<Func<TestEntity, string>> invalidExpression = x => x.Name.Substring(0, 1);
166var gridSort = GridSort<TestEntity>.ByAscending(invalidExpression);
175Expression<Func<TestEntity, string>> invalidExpression = x => "constant";
178var gridSort = GridSort<TestEntity>.ByAscending(invalidExpression);